Ultrafast Dynamics of Liquid Water

Abstract

Understanding the molecular properties of liquid water, and in particular, the connection between the molecular (microscopic) and macroscopic properties of water is, and has for a long time been an important challenge in physical chemistry. Using femtosecond laser techniques many important new observations have been reported over the last 20 years, and in connection with the theoretical advances, in particular molecular dynamics simulations, the general understanding of liquid water has improved considerably. In this talk we will describe a series of experiments where the ultrafast dynamics of liquid water was probed directly or indirectly using different solutes.
